NBA rumors: Much like Damian Lillard’s situation with the Portland Trail Blazers, James Harden is still in the midst of a holdout with his current team, the Philadelphia 76ers. We all know that the former league MVP wants out and that the Los Angeles Clippers are his preferred destination. However, the Sixers and the Clippers just haven’t found a way to make a deal work.

With all this dillydallying, other teams in the NBA could potentially step in and offer a trade package to the Sixers that would make them think twice about their stern asking price for the 10-time All-Star.
Lee Tran of Fadeaway World suggests that that team could be the Boston Celtics. With Harden in the mix, the Celtics will be able to form one of the most fearsome Big 3s in the NBA with Jayson Tatum and Jaylen Brown. Boston has been knocking on the door of a championship over the past few years, and James Harden could be the missing piece that finally takes them over the hump.
Tran points out that the fact that Harden is set to become a free agent next summer makes him a potential one-year rental for Boston. However, this could also work in the Celtics’ favor:
“As of right now, James Harden’s trade value is lower due to his contract situation. This is the perfect opportunity for the Boston Celtics to add talent and increase the team’s ceiling. Though there is obviously the chance of James Harden leaving for nothing at the end of the season, if the team is winning, then Harden will likely want to stay,” Tran wrote.
NBA Rumors: What Will Celtics Need to Give Up for James Harden?
The biggest reason why James Harden is still in Philly right now is because the Sixers have refused to budge on their trade demands for the 33-year-old. Tran suggests, however, that the Celtics could create a package centered around Derrick White and Malcolm Brogdon.
Tran admits that this exchange would not exactly be in the same region as the massive haul the 76ers have been demanding. However, the fact that they’re adding two quality veterans to their backcourt to replace Harden could make Philly think twice about this offer. Malcolm Brogdon is coming off a Sixth Man of the Year title, while Derrick White has been killing it in the offseason, and could be on the brink of a breakout campaign.
Much like the Celtics, the Sixers are one or two pieces away from being a legitimate threat to the title. Brogdon and White are no stars, but alongside Joel Embiid and Tyrese Maxey, Philly might just be able to take it to the next level.
